JetBlue to sell Spirit’s LaGuardia assets to Frontier

BLOOMBERG JetBlue Airways Corp agreed to sell Spirit Airlines Inc’s operations at New York’s LaGuardia Airport to rival carrier Frontier Group Holdings Inc. The deal is contingent upon JetBlue closing a planned $3.8 billion acquisition of Spirit, according to a statement. Macy’s lowers outlook as sales weaken, shares drop

BLOOMBERG Macy’s Inc said earnings will be weaker than previously expected for the full-year, underscoring the uncertainty around US consumer spending through the remainder of 2023. The department-store retailer said it would take markdowns and other measures to address excess spring merchandise in order to meet current consumer demand. US fines British Airways $1.1m over pandemic flight refunds

BLOOMBERG British Airways (BA) was fined $1.1 million by the US Department of Transportation after it determined that the airline had failed to offer passengers timely refunds for canceled flights to and from the US during the Covid-19 pandemic.
